Except a proper GT on PS4 would never have been ready for launch. On the PS3, they are able to reuse the engine they built for GT5 as well as most of the assets. This is why Drive Club is a launch window title for PS4. In addition, PS3 has a larger install base, and GT is Sony's best selling franchise. They would severely constrict their sales by launching it alongside the PS4. PS4 will get a proper GT, but it's obviously going to take some time.
